Going into this game, teams with a -3 turnover differential were 0-13

Since 2000, the win rate with a -3 differential are 82-753-2 (9.8% win rate)

Packers did it today.

However, Cowboys did it to Pittsburgh 2 weeks ago, Pittsburgh’s lone turnover came on their lateral play to end the game

Sometimes you have to win ugly.
GB had more first downs.
3rd down conversions.
Total yards.
Total Yards per play.
Passing yards.
Completions.
Passing Yards per play.
Stacked Houston more.
Red zone conversions.

The running game was close enough. While the Texans had 142 rushing yards it took them 33 attempts to get it. Packers had only 82 yards on 20 attempts. One of the big play staples for the Packers is the WR sweeps. 3 attempts for -5 yards. Even with a depleted defense it wasn't working for GB. Best to move on. Teams are scouting it so they will have to shelve it for now.

The defense was dominate.
The "Great" Stroud only had 86 yards passing. 86!
His QB rating is over 100. Today- 58.8! We talk about MLF being in his bag dialing up plays for the offense. Today it was Hafley's schemes that harassed Stroud all day long.

The Packers dominated so much that they tried to give the game away. The offense gave up 16 points and yet the Packers STILL won. Without those mistakes they would have won by 30. At least 20.
